Abstract
Focusing relativistic-intensity pulses to the wavelength scale in plasma leads to the formation of isolated attosecond pulses with ten percent efficiency in simulations. Experiments show this relativistic electron motion is present at 5/spl times/10/sup 17/ W/cm/sup 2/.
